img {
      border: 0px;
    }

/* RandomImage plugin */
.randomImage {
               width: 190px;
              /* height: 190px;*/
               margin-top:15px;
               border: 1px solid black;
             }
             
/* Calendar plugin */
.calendar { 
            margin-left: 45px; 
            margin-left = 45px;
            margin-top: 15px;
            border:1px;
            overflow:auto;
            height:180px;
            float:left;
            width:220px;
            border: 1px solid black;
          }
          
.calendarTable { 
                width: 201px;
                 color: black;
                 font-size: 13px;
                 background-color: #addd3e;
                 
                 text-align:center;
               }

.calendarTable2 { 
                width: 201px;
                 color: black;
                 font-size: 11px;
                 background-color: #addd3e;
                 
                 text-align:left;
                   border-top:0px;
                 
                 table-layout : auto;
               }
               
.calendarTable3 { 
                width: 201px;
                 color: black;
                 font-size: 11px;
                 background-color: #addd3e;
                 
                 text-align:right;
                 border-top:0px;
               }
.calendarTable4 { 
                width: 201px;
                 color: black;
                 font-size: 11px;
                 background-color: #addd3e;
                 
                 text-align:left;
                
                 border-bottom:0px;
               }
                  
.randomtext { 
                width: 192px;
                 color: black;
                 font-size: 11px;
                 background-color: #addd3e;
                 border: 1px solid black;
                 border-top:3px solid black;
                 text-align:left;
                 margin-left:11px; margin-left = 0px;
                 margin-top: -3px;
                 margin-top = -3px;
                 margin-right= 10px;
                 

               }
           
.calendarLink {
               text-decoration:none;
               color: black;
              }

/* Menu plugin */
.menu {
        text-align:right;
        margin-top: 115px;
        margin-right: 35px; margin-right=0px;
      }

.menuOdkaz {
             color: fff;
             font-size:12px;
             text-decoration:none;
             font-family:Lucida console;
           }
           
.menuOdkaz:hover {
                   color: #ddfb76;
                 }
                 
.menuOdkazActive {
                    color: #ddfb76;
                    font-weight: bold;
                    text-decoration:none;
                  }
                  
#sddm
{	margin: 0;
	padding: 0;
	z-index: 30}

#sddm li
{	margin: 0;
	padding: 0;
	list-style: none;
	float: left;
	font: bold 13px arial}

#sddm li a
{	display: block;
	margin: 0 5px 0 0; 
	padding: 4px 10px; 
	width : 59px;
	width = 79px;
	height: 18px;
	background: #6d9f00;
	background-image: url('uploaded/butbg.jpg');
	color: black;
	text-align: center;  text-align=left;
	text-decoration: none}

#sddm li a:hover
{	background: #d4fb7f}

#sddm div
{	position: absolute;
	visibility: hidden;
	margin: 0;
	padding: 0;
	background: #d4fb7f;
	border: 1px solid black}

	#sddm div a
	{	position: relative;
		display: block;
		margin: 0;
		padding: 5px 10px; 
		
		width: auto;
		height: 18px;
		white-space: nowrap;
		float = left;
		text-align: left;
		text-decoration: none;
		background: #d4fb7f;
		color: black;
		font: 13px arial}
	
	#noleft{float = none;}

	#sddm div a:hover
	{	background: #6d9f00;
		color: black}    
	
	.leftbut {
          background-image:url('images/leftbut.gif');
          background-color:black;
          }
          
  .rightbut {
          background-image:url('images/rightbut.gif');
          background-color:black;
          }
/* Panel */
.panel { 
        margin:0px; 
        font-size: 12px;
        font-weight:bold;
       }
       
/* News */
.news{
       width:350px;
       text-align:left;
       float:left;
      
     }
.news23{
       width:680px;
       text-align:left;
       float:left;
       margin-left:40px;
       margin-top:5px;
       margin-bottom:5px;
       
       
       
      
     }
.newsImage {
            text-align:left;
            float:left;
           
           }
           
.newsImage2 {
            
            width: 125px;
            float:left;
            border: 1px solid black;
            margin-right:5px; margin-bottom:5px;
           }
 .newsImage23 {
            width: 150px;
           
            float:left;
            border: 1px solid black;
            margin-right:10px;
            margin-bottom:5px;
           }      
           
            .newsImage24 {
            
            height: 150px;
            
            border: 1px solid black;
            margin-right:10px;
            margin-bottom:5px;
           }        
           
           .newsImage25 {
            
            height: 300px;
            
            border: 1px solid black;
            
            margin-bottom:5px;
           }     
           
           .nastred{
            
            text-align:center;
            float:center;
            width:640px;
           }
           
.newsNadpis {
             float:left;
             font-size:15px;
             font-weight: bold;
             text-align:left;
             margin-left:5px;
             
             
            }
.newsNadpis23 {
             float:left;
             font-size:18px;
             font-weight: bold;
             text-align:left;
             
             
             width: 510px;
            }
.newsDatum{
            font-size:10px;
            color:gray;
            float:left;
            
          }      
.newsUvodnik {
               
               float:left;
               /*height: 50px;*/
               font-size: 12px;
               overflow: hidden;
               margin-left:5px;
                margin-top:5px;
                text-align:left;
             }
 .newsUvodnik23 {
               width: 510px;
               float:left;
               /*height: 50px;*/
               font-size: 12px;
               overflow: hidden;
              
                margin-top:5px;
                text-align:left;
                color:rgb(96,96,96);
             }           
.newsText {
            float:left;
            margin-left:5px;
            text-align:left;
            margin-top: 5px;
            font-size: 12px;
            text-align:left;
            width: 310px;
          }

.newsText23 {
            float:left;
            margin-left:10px;
            text-align:left;
            margin-top: 5px;
            font-size: 12px;
            text-align:left;
            
          }
          
.komentare {
             text-align:left;
             font-size:11px;
           }

.archiv {
          font-size:12px;
        }
          
/* latestNews */

.latestText {
              font-size: 10px;
              text-align:left;
            }
            
.latestText2 {
              font-size: 10px;
              text-align:left;
              margin-left:-5px;
              margin-left=0px;
            }

.latestImage {
               width:80px;
               height: 80px;
            
              
               margin-bottom:5px;
             }
.latestImage2 {
               width:75px;
               height: 75px;
               border: 1px solid black;
               
             }
             
/* user */
.user {
        text-align:left;
        margin-top: 20px;
        margin-left:20px;
      }
      
.userForm {
          }
          
/* adv */
.adv {
       text-align:right;
       margin-top:270px;
       color:white;
       font-size:10px;
     }

/* Kontakt */
.kontaktImage {
                width: 90px;
              }
              
/* Exhibice */
    /* Nabidka */
      .nabidka{
                text-align:left;
              }
              
/* Akce */
.akcefoto{
           width:290px;
         }
a { color:rgb(0,80,0); font-weight:bold; text-decoration:none;}

/* dodelavky */
.galerkaimg {
  width:75px;
  height:50px;
  border: black 1px solid;
}

.galerkaimg2 {
  width:81px;
  height:91px;
  border: black 1px solid;
}

.galerkaimg3 {
  width:100px;
  height:100px;
  border: black 1px solid;
}

.galerkaimg4{
  width:300px;
}

.count {color:white; text-align:right; margin-right:10px;}

.mezera {float:left; width: 300px;height:10px; margin-top:5px; }

.righter{margin-right:10px;}
.cerny {text-decoration:none; color:black;}
.toleft {text-align:left;}
.nprofile{font-size:12px; }
.ntexttab{margin-left:5px; margin-top:auto;}
.nfoto {width:150px; border:1px solid black;}
.galerie {font-size:12px;}
.txt {font-size:12px;}
.komentphoto {width:20px; height:20px; border:1 px black solid;}
.arch {text-align:left;}
.lefter {margin-left=-35px;}
.scara {border: black 1px dashed;}
.scara2 {border:black 1px dashed; width:340px; float:left; margin-top:5px;}
.scara3 {border:black 1px dashed; width:340px; float:left; margin-top:5px; width=280px;}
.b-left{position:absolute; margin-top:4px; margin-left:-10px; margin-top=2px; margin-left=-10px;}
.b-right{position:absolute; margin-top:4px; margin-left:51px; margin-top=2px; margin-left=51px;}
.b-right2{position:absolute; margin-top:4px; margin-left:51px; margin-top=2px; margin-left=51px; }
.userTable{text-align:left; padding:10px; background-color:#addd3e; border: 1px solid black; margin-left:-5px; font-size:10px;}
.tomid{ width=59px; text-align:center;}